The student Ekhlas Falih obtained her PhD degree from the Department of Computer Sciences / University of Technology for her dissertation. That proposed a system used the BOVW to understand the event in which the video data is extracted and compiled to generate a group Of the visual words that form the visual dictionary. As a pre-processing phase, the video images are converted to gray and then converted using the Haar filter for the purpose of implementing the proposed algorithms with minimal complexity. The first stage of the proposed visual system is to extract important points from the images. The proposed system used FAST characteristics to extract angles as important points. The FAST has been improved by proposing an adaptive threshold rather than a fixed threshold to reduce the space of attributes and increase the speed of implementation of the proposed system. After discovering the important points, the proposed system uses SURF as a second stage of the video bag system to build the local descriptor for these important points and generate a signature for the image that is fixed with rotation and zoom.
